Facial fat compartments: a guide to filler placement.

Safa E Sandoval1, Joshua A Cox, John C Koshy, Daniel A Hatef, Larry H Hollier.   

Abstract

Advances in anatomic understanding are frequently the basis upon which surgical techniques are advanced and refined. Recent anatomic studies of the superficial tissues of the face have led to an increased understanding of the compartmentalized nature of the subcutaneous fat. This report provides a review of the locations and characteristics of the facial fat compartments and provides examples of how this knowledge can be used clinically, specifically with regard to soft tissue fillers.
